Commercial masonry repair services involve the assessment, restoration, and reinforcement of masonry structures used in commercial properties. These services typically address issues such as cracked or deteriorated brickwork, damaged mortar joints, spalling concrete, and other forms of structural wear.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to restore the integrity and appearance of masonry elements, helping to prevent further damage and extend the lifespan of the structure. Regular repairs can also improve the safety and stability of commercial buildings, ensuring they meet necessary standards and remain functional.

The primary problems addressed by commercial masonry repair include structural weakening caused by weather exposure, age, or improper initial construction. Over time, moisture infiltration can cause mortar joints to degrade, leading to loose or falling bricks. Cracks and other damages can compromise the stability of load-bearing walls, facades, or decorative features. Repair services help to seal these vulnerabilities, preventing water intrusion, reducing the risk of further deterioration, and maintaining the aesthetic appeal of the property. Properly executed repairs can also help avoid costly replacements or extensive rebuilding in the future.

Properties that typically utilize commercial masonry repair services encompass a range of building types, including office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and institutional structures like schools and hospitals. These properties often feature brick, stone, concrete, or block masonry that requires ongoing maintenance or urgent repairs. Commercial properties usually face higher foot traffic and environmental exposure, which can accelerate masonry deterioration. Regular inspections and timely repairs are essential for maintaining the structural integrity and visual appeal of these buildings.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lincolnton,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range for Masonry Repairs - The typical cost for commercial masonry repair services varies based on the scope of work, generally falling between $1,000 and $10,000. Smaller repairs, such as crack fixes, may be closer to $1,000, while extensive wall restorations can exceed $10,000.

Factors Influencing Pricing - Costs depend on the size and complexity of the project, with larger or more intricate repairs increasing expenses. For example, replacing damaged bricks on a storefront might cost around $3,000 to $7,000, depending on materials and labor.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Repair costs are often estimated per square foot, typically ranging from $10 to $30. For instance, repairing a 500-square-foot masonry wall could cost between $5,000 and $15,000.

Additional Expenses - Unexpected issues like structural concerns or material replacement can add to the overall cost. Contact local masonry repair provid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ific commercial building needs in Lincolnton, NC, and surrounding are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ial masonry repair services are available? Local service providers typically offer repairs for cracked or damaged bricks, mortar joint restoration, tuckpointing, and structural reinforcement of masonry walls.

How can I tell if my commercial masonry needs repair? Signs such as visible cracks, crumbling mortar, water infiltration, or leaning walls indicate that masonry repair may be necessary.

What are common causes of masonry damage in commercial buildings? Factors like weather exposure, ground movement, poor initial construction, and aging can contribute to masonry deterioration.
